WOW! What an incredible start to 2025 for We Are Mobilise. If you haven’t heard already, Mobilise was the official charity partner for triple j’s Hottest 100 this year, and we just raised $400,000 for homelessness! That’s enough to cover over 24 years of housing through our Kickstarter Program.
The Hottest 100 is triple j’s annual poll of your favourite songs. Each year, hundreds of thousands of people from all around the world choose the songs that have soundtracked their life, leading to one hell of a listening party on January 25th. Every year, triple j works with a charity, selling Hottest 100 t-shirts to raise money for a good cause, and we were lucky enough to be that charity this year.
Triple j fans all over the country bought t-shirts for $45, which covers a night of housing for someone doing it tough through our Mobilise Kickstarter program. Not only did people buy tees, but so many generous Aussies donated directly to Mobilise, and in total we were able to raise a massive $400,000!
We’re so proud of the Mobilise Kickstarter program, where we cover bond and rent, to get people into housing, and help break the cycle of homelessness.
